自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(16)
  • 收藏
  • 关注

原创 cocos2d-x 集成移动游戏基地 sdk包 cmgame 遇到的问题

在cocos2d-x 集成 cmgame时,有时会遇到这个错误02-26 16:51:18.565: W/dalvikvm(16222): JNI WARNING: JNI method called with exception pending02-26 16:51:18.565: W/dalvikvm(16222):              in Ljava/lang/Run

2014-02-26 17:01:00 5448 3

原创 C++基础类模版

.h-------->>>#ifndef __HSChannel_H__#define __HSChannel_H__#pragma once#include "HSTool.h"class HSChannel{public:HSChannel(void);~HSChannel(void);st

2014-02-24 13:17:45 711

转载 Java异常处理机制【转载】

一、 异常的概念和Java异常体系结构    异常是程序运行过程中出现的错误。本文主要讲授的是Java语言的异常处理。Java语言的异常处理框架,是Java语言健壮性的一个重要体现。    Java把异常当作对象来处理,并定义一个基类java.lang.Throwable作为所有异常的超类。在Java API中已经定义了许多异常类,这些异常类分为两大类,错误Error和异常Exce

2014-02-20 21:30:59 442

转载 java wait和notify时不起作用要注意的事项。

1. wait和notify永远都是要synchronized块里面执行的synchronized(对象){对象.wait(); // 或者 对象.notify(); } 2. synchronized中的对象不能被修改,之前就是使用一个静态变量,然后修改它的值 ,结果就不起作用了,永远不能notify了。最好是使用final或者以参数的形式传递进去

2014-02-20 21:30:12 2655

转载 fat jar 安装

Fat Jar Eclipse Plug-In是一个可以将Eclipse Java Project的所有资源打包进一个可执行jar文件的小工具,可以方便的完成各种打包任务,我们经常会来打jar包,但是eclipse自带的打jar似乎不太够用,Fat Jar是eclipse的一个插件,特别是Fat Jar可以打成可执行Jar包,并且在图片等其他资源、引用外包方面使用起来更方便。 安装方法:

2014-02-20 21:29:39 753

转载 android 获取SD、ROM容量

SD卡及ROM容量获取,先获取SD及ROM的路径,再根据该路径创建StatFs对象,利用其中方法即可获取容量及其他信息。//SD容量显示        private void show_SD_storage()    {        // 先判断有无SD卡        if(Environment.getExternalStorageState().e

2014-02-20 16:51:44 782

转载 Android 系统信息获取(CPU,RAM,ROM,Battery,SD-card,版本等)

一、内存(ram):android的总内存大小信息存放在系统的/proc/meminfo文件里面,可以通过读取这个文件来获取这些信息:[java] view plaincopypublic void getTotalMemory() {          String str1 = "/proc/meminfo";

2014-02-20 16:39:39 889

转载 Android静默安装

想要做到静默安装,其实就是要有权限执行pm install命令。准备工作其实就两步:1、获取执行权限2、执行命令我们首先介绍第二步,如何执行pm install命令:关键代码其实就一句:Runtime.getRuntime().exec("pm install xxx.apk");网上也有人提到利用BufferReader读取控制台的输出Success来判断是否

2014-02-20 11:24:53 583

转载 shell脚本批量修改目录下所有文件中的部分语句

#!/bin/shfunction scandir() {    firstdir=$1    cd $firstdir    for filename in `ls $firstdir`;do        if [ -d $filename ];then        firstdir=`pwd`/$filename            cd $firstdir

2014-02-14 10:56:20 830 1

转载 Linux用shell修改文件内容

sed -i 's/abc/xxx/g' fileabc修改前的字符串xxx是修改后的字符串file是要被修改的文件例如:我有一个文件是map_server#!/bin/bash# chkconfig: 2345 10 90# description: Starts and Stops the MapServer.DIRECTORY=xxxxxx

2014-02-14 10:53:55 1827

转载 Reactor模式和NIO

本文可看成是对Doug Lea Scalable IO in Java一文的翻译。当前分布式计算 Web Services盛行天下,这些网络服务的底层都离不开对socket的操作。他们都有一个共同的结构:1. Read request2. Decode request3. Process service4. Encode reply5. Send reply经典

2014-02-08 17:56:55 533

转载 Java NIO原理和使用

Java NIO非堵塞应用通常适用用在I/O读写等方面,我们知道,系统运行的性能瓶颈通常在I/O读写,包括对端口和文件的操作上,过去,在打开一个I/O通道后,read()将一直等待在端口一边读取字节内容,如果没有内容进来,read()也是傻傻的等,这会影响我们程序继续做其他事情,那么改进做法就是开设线程,让线程去等待,但是这样做也是相当耗费资源的。Java NIO非堵塞技术实际是采取Rea

2014-02-08 17:55:47 524

转载 JAVA NIO 简介

1.   基本 概念IO 是主存和外部设备 ( 硬盘、终端和网络等 ) 拷贝数据的过程。 IO 是操作系统的底层功能实现,底层通过 I/O 指令进行完成。所有语言运行时系统提供执行 I/O 较高级别的工具。 (c 的 printf scanf,java 的面向对象封装 )2.    Java 标准 io 回顾Java 标准 IO 类库是 io 面向对象的一种抽象。基于本地方法的底层

2014-02-08 16:03:13 424

转载 export 命令

shell与export命令(将一个shell局部变量变成一个shell全局变量)用户登录到Linux系统后,系统将启动一个用户shell。在这个shell中,可以使用shell命令或声明变量,也可以创建并运行shell脚本程序。运行shell脚本程序时,系统将创建一个子shell。此时,系统中将有两个shell,一个是登录时系统启动的shell,另一个是系统为运行脚本程序创建的she

2014-02-08 10:46:15 876

转载 mkdir命令

linux mkdir 命令用来创建指定的名称的目录,要求创建目录的用户在当前目录中具有写权限,并且指定的目录名不能是当前目录中已有的目录。1.命令格式:mkdir [选项] 目录...2.命令功能:通过 mkdir 命令可以实现在指定位置创建以 DirName(指定的文件名)命名的文件夹或目录。要创建文件夹或目录的用户必须对所创建的文件夹的父文件夹具有写权限。并且

2014-02-08 10:11:28 550

转载 linux rm 命令详解

名称:rm 使用权限:所有使用者 使用方式:rm [options] name... 说明:删除档案及目录。 参数: -i 删除前逐一询问确认。 -f 即使原档案属性设为唯读,亦直接删除,无需逐一确认。 -r 将目录及以下之档案亦逐一删除。 范例: 删除所有C语言程式档;删除前逐一询问确认 : rm -i *.c 将 Finished 子目录及子目录中

2014-02-08 09:53:58 1012

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除